The candidates who are interested in the field of Physics are offered a higher study option in the specified field. The requirement of an aspirant to apply for a Master of Science in Physics is a pass in the Bachelor of Science exam. The over all aggregate percentage required in the degree is fixed by the concerned college or University. Yet another requirement for an aspirant is a pass in the entrance test conducted by the concerned college or University. There are a lot of entrance exams conducted by various authorities to admit students into the corresponding institutions. The details regarding the entrance exam are as follows.

How to get Application form for M.Sc Physics Entrance exams?

The candidates can get the application forms by visiting the official website of the corresponding University or college. They can download it and fill it carefully and can send to the specified address along with the required documents. Or else they can get the form by post by sending a request to the concerned office along with a DD of mentioned amount.

Cost of different M.Sc Physics entrance exams

The cost of the application forms vary according to the chosen college or University. The cost of the form also varies within the same University or college depending on the category of the concerned student. The cost of the forms for the general category candidates ranges from Rs.350-Rs.550 and that of the OBC candidates ranges from Rs.150 to Rs.300. Most of the authorities do not demand any fees from the reserved category candidates and some of the authorities demand only a negligible amount from them as compared to the fees of the other candidates.

How to Fill the M.Sc Physics Entrance Application form?

Before filling up the application, the candidate should pay the fees in any branches of the mentioned bank or else they should take a DD of mentioned amount as mentioned in the exam brochure. Any ways the candidate should be ready with the fees payment proof as they have to fill details regarding that in the form. In online method the candidate is advised to visit the official website and complete the online form with great accuracy and should click the submit button. They will give a register number and password which should be saved for future reference. In offline method the candidate should buy the form and fill it with great accuracy using pen or pencil as mentioned in the brochure and send it to the corresponding address along with the required documents.
